Slender: The Arrival Is Getting A Huge Unreal Engine 5.2 Update

Guess who's back?

After teasing an announcement a month ago, viral horror title Slender: The Arrival’s original developer Blue Isle Studios has revealed that it’s celebrating the game’s 10th anniversary (has it really been that long??) in style, by releasing a massive new upgrade to the game with Unreal Engine 5.2-powered visuals to bring it kicking and screaming to a modern standard.

Slender: The Arrival’s upcoming “10 Year Anniversary Update” is set to overhaul the game’s visuals to give it new life and an enhanced, spooky atmosphere along with improvements to how the game itself plays. The differences are quite stark in comparison, owing to both the time passed and the capabilities of Unreal Engine 5.2. Everything from lighting to effects, materials, models and more have all been redone in incredible detail.

The update is reportedly set to launch later this year in October (appropriately), but no further details around an exact date or upgrade paths, pricing, etc have been revealed just yet.

Along with the big Slender: The Arrival update, Blue Isle Studios also revealed that it’s working on a brand new horror experience, titled S: The Lost Chapters.

While details for this new title are still thin on the ground, the developer’s own description of S: The Lost Chapters reads calls on fans of the spooky and scary to, “Prepare for a brand new type of horror. Delve deeper into the depths of infamous stories once told and unearth the terrible secrets left behind. Brace yourself for an immersive journey that is equal parts horrifying and breathtaking. An experience that is both familiar, yet different…”
